What Is Included in a Nissan Sentra Lease Price?
The lease price typically includes the base monthly payment, taxes, fees, and sometimes additional costs like acquisition fees or security deposits. The monthly payment is based on factors such as the vehicle’s capitalized cost (agreed-upon value), residual value (estimated value at lease end), money factor (interest rate equivalent), and lease term. It’s important to review your contract carefully to understand all included charges.
Factors That Affect Nissan Sentra Lease Prices
Several factors impact how much you’ll pay to lease a Nissan Sentra. These include your credit score, which influences the money factor or interest rate; regional incentives or promotions offered by dealerships; trim level and optional features of the vehicle; length of the lease term; annual mileage limits set by the leasing company; and local taxes or fees that may vary by state or city.
How Mileage Limits Influence Lease Pricing
Most leases come with annual mileage limits ranging from 10,000 to 15,000 miles per year. Exceeding these limits results in excess mileage fees charged at the end of your lease term. To avoid unexpected costs, it’s essential to estimate your driving habits accurately when negotiating your mileage allowance since higher limits usually increase monthly payments but offer more flexibility.
Comparing Leasing vs Buying a Nissan Sentra
Leasing offers lower monthly payments compared to financing a purchase because you’re only paying for depreciation during the term rather than full ownership costs. However, leases have restrictions like mileage caps and no ownership equity at contract end. Buying might be better for long-term ownership or if you drive extensively yearly. Understanding these differences helps determine which option fits your lifestyle and budget best.
